To get things going one could create a page on the wiki and post a source tarball there. Then others can download an evaluate. Another stage would be to possible to create a project as part of the osgforge to sit alongside Present3D, osgLua, osgPython, VirtualPlanetBuilder, osgProducer and OsgDotNet. There is the possible inclusion in a future rev of the OSG, but this will have to be post 2.2. > I'd like to structure the directories so its easy to incorporate into wherever > its going. Should I put it into its own subfolders or try to merge it into > some > existing osg folder? Ideally mimic the OSG structure and use CMake too. The VirtualPlanetBuilder might be a reasonable template as this has the vpb lib and osgdem app all built with CMake.
